How does it happen?

Over the course of this 20-week program, you will begin by "Discovering the Lies" that stem from unresolved pain. Then, you'll move on to "Identifying Default Behaviors" you've developed to cope with that pain. You'll then learn how to live as an "Overcomer," empowered by the Spirit to adopt new thought patterns, emotions, and actions. Ultimately, you will "Experience Freedom" as healing occurs and you release the pain, falsehoods, and harmful behaviors that have been hindering your progress.

What's the Commitment?

Sessions are held once a week via Zoom for 20 weeks. Each group session lasts for 90 minutes and the group size is no larger than 8 individuals, same gender.
